发明名称 Executing a batch process on a repository of information based on an analysis of the information in the repository
摘要 Embodiments of the invention provide for executing a batch process on a repository of information. According to one embodiment, executing a batch process can comprise presenting one or more aspects of records of the repository and receiving a selection of a criteria for at least one aspect of the records. Records matching the selected criteria can be identified and a summary of the information can be presented. The batch process can comprise one of a plurality of batch processes. In such a case, a selection of the batch process can be received and parameters of the batch process can be populated with the selected criteria. The batch process can then be executed with the parameters. For example, executing the batch process can comprise generating a report based on the parameters and the records of the repository.
申请公布号 US9563668(B2) 申请公布日期 2017.02.07
申请号 US200812339673 申请日期 2008.12.19
申请人 Oracle International Corporation 发明人 Tollefson Lynda;Hunur Nagaraj M.;Manyam Balamurali;Bodla Prasad;Kawanishi Ashton
分类号 G06F17/30 主分类号 G06F17/30
代理机构 Kilpatrick Townsend & Stockton LLP 代理人 Kilpatrick Townsend & Stockton LLP
主权项 1. A method of executing a batch process on a plurality of records in a database, the method comprising: presenting, by a computer system, a plurality of aspects of the plurality of records, each aspect defining a general category of information in the plurality of records and comprising one or more criteria, each of the one or more criteria defining a specific sub-category of information in the plurality of records; receiving, by the computer system, a selection of a criterion of the one or more criteria for at least one aspect of the plurality of records; analyzing, by the computer system, the plurality of records to identify one or more records that match the selected criterion for each of at least one aspect of the plurality of records based on the selected criterion for each of at least one aspect of the plurality of records and aspects of the plurality of records before executing one or more of a plurality of batch processes, wherein the selected criterion for each of at least one aspect of the plurality of records and aspects of the plurality of records relate to one or more parameters of the one or more of the plurality of batch processes, and wherein analyzing the one or more records comprises executing one or more queries on one or more periodically updated summary tables of the database; presenting, by the computer system, a summary of the database based on the analysis of the plurality of records, wherein presenting the summary of the database based on the analysis of the plurality of records comprises providing a graph and a table, the graph providing a summary of information in the database based on the selected criterion for each of at least one aspect of the plurality of records and the table comprising a list of reports and a corresponding number of records in the database related to each report and wherein each entry in the list of reports comprises a link to a batch process associated with the report; receiving, by the computer system, a selection of a batch process from the plurality of batch processes; populating, by the computer system, the one or more parameters of the selected batch process with the selected criterion for each of at least one aspect of the plurality of records; and executing, by the computer system, the selected batch process with the populated one or more parameters.
地址 Redwood Shores CA US